For those that trying to learn the CJ4 in time for Friday. (I’ve never flown it before). :slight_smile:
If you use the Working Title mod, when you start up, the default behavior is NOT to import the flight plan from the sim.
From the manual of the WT mod…

Flight Plan Synchronization Between the Game and FMS

  • You can still “file” your flight plan to ATC by entering it in the world map of MSFS and it will remain visible to ATC/VFR.
  • To load the plan into the FMS you can either enter it manually or use the FPLN RECALL (GAME/SB) option in IDX → PAGE2 → ROUTE MENU
  • Due to the increased accuracy and capabilities of the FMC managed flight plan, you may find that the sync to the game does not always work as expected or does not reflect the FMC flight plan.

And watching the video is great, but a > 2 hour investment in time.

EDIT: Also, if you forget at power on, IDX → POS INIT → SET POS TO GNSS
